video: driver: queue deferred buffers during IPSC

Queue pending buffers from decode_batch during ipsc to avoid
reconfig latency. So added change to queue all pending buffers,
if inst->state is not in START state.

@@ -1725,12 +1725,38 @@ error:
 	return rc;
 }
 
+static inline enum msm_vidc_allow msm_vdec_allow_queue_deferred_buffers(
+	struct msm_vidc_inst *inst)
+{
+	int count;
+
+	if (!inst) {
+		d_vpr_e("%s: invalid params\n", __func__);
+		return MSM_VIDC_DISALLOW;
+	}
+
+	/* do not defer buffers initially to avoid latency issues */
+	if (inst->power.buffer_counter <= SKIP_BATCH_WINDOW)
+		return MSM_VIDC_ALLOW;
+
+	/* do not defer, if client waiting for last flag FBD */
+	if (inst->state != MSM_VIDC_START)
+		return MSM_VIDC_ALLOW;
+
+	/* defer qbuf, if pending buffers count less than batch size */
+	count = msm_vidc_num_buffers(inst, MSM_VIDC_BUF_OUTPUT, MSM_VIDC_ATTR_DEFERRED);
+	if (count < inst->decode_batch.size)
+		return MSM_VIDC_DEFER;
+
+	return MSM_VIDC_ALLOW;
+}
+
